Yes it would get very tedious indeed to have to answer all the
questions each time you unpack a new kernel.  What you can do is take
the .config from a previous built kernel and copy it into the new
directory after you do the make mrproper.  Then do make oldconfig
which will go through the .config and only ask you about configuration
options which are new or have changed since the original .config was
made.  You can do a make or make bzImage modules_install and build
everything.
